Re: HID's with auto lights
if you have reflector lenses, make sure you use H7R bulbs or you'll be blinding everyone

Re: HID's with auto lights
I fitted in 8000K they look awesome driving but because they are standard lens and not projectors I blind anyone so grab some projects lamps if you can.
